  • AC has never been a series that claimed to be historically accurate, right from the very first AC game Ubisoft opened the series with a disclaimer that read "Inspired by historical events and characters, this work of fiction was developed by a multicultural team of various religious faiths and beliefs". The series has always taken a pretty loose approach with the lives of real life historical figures.
  • Therefore, Yasuke's inclusion doesn't really bother me so much, he was a real historical figure, and if they want to portray him as a full samurai in armor rather than the retainer he actually was, I personally don't see how that is any different than portraying Pope Alexander VI as a man with a magical staff.
  • I take issue more with some of their other design choices, the hip-hop infused soundtrack for Yasuke's combat seems badly out of place, the poor research they did into architecture, clothing, and the manners and customs of the time period are out of character for Ubisoft who usually did well in those areas for other AC games.
